In the aerospace sector, self-locking gas springs are integral components used in a range of applications including aircraft cabin systems, cargo holds, and aircraft seat adjustments. These springs ensure smooth operation in situations where precision and reliability are crucial. The ability of these springs to lock securely at desired positions enhances safety, especially in high-altitude environments, and contributes to the overall comfort and operational efficiency of aircraft. In the automotive industry, self-locking gas springs play a vital role in various vehicle applications such as trunk lid supports, hoods, tailgates, and seat adjustments. These springs provide controlled motion and secure locking mechanisms, offering convenience and safety to both manufacturers and end-users. Their ability to handle heavy loads and ensure smooth, reliable operation under various environmental conditions makes them an ideal choice for the automotive sector. Self-locking gas springs in the medical field are essential for providing adjustable and secure positioning in various medical devices such as hospital beds, examination tables, and patient lifts. These gas springs help improve patient comfort and facilitate better functionality of medical equipment. In settings such as surgery rooms or intensive care units (ICUs), where precise and reliable equipment operation is critical, the importance of self-locking gas springs cannot be overstated. In the furniture industry, self-locking gas springs are primarily used in adjustable chairs, desks, beds, and other office furniture to provide height adjustment and tilting functionalities. These springs allow for smooth and effortless movement, offering comfort and ergonomic benefits to users. Self-locking gas springs are widely used in industrial and agricultural machinery for functions such as machine covers, doors, and adjustable parts. These springs provide controlled motion and safe locking capabilities, which are particularly beneficial in heavy-duty machinery and equipment that operates in rugged environments. In agricultural applications, gas springs are employed in equipment such as combine harvesters, tractors, and plows, ensuring that parts remain securely in place during operation while also offering ease of adjustment. What is a self-locking gas spring?
A self-locking gas spring is a mechanical component that uses gas pressure to provide force and allow for easy adjustments, with a built-in locking mechanism to hold the position securely.
What are the main applications of self-locking gas springs?
Self-locking gas springs are commonly used in aerospace, automotive, medical, furniture, industrial machinery, and agricultural machinery applications, offering adjustable support and safety features.
How do self-locking gas springs work?
These springs use a combination of gas and a piston mechanism to create force that can be controlled, allowing for easy position adjustments and secure locking when needed.
Are self-locking gas springs customizable?
Yes, self-locking gas springs can be customized in terms of size, force, and stroke length to meet specific requirements of various industries and applications.
